Christina Dobbs
Christina L. Dobbs is an associate professor and director of the English Education for Equity and Justice program at Boston University’s Wheelock College of Education & Human Development. Her research focuses on adolescent writing development in the disciplines, supporting culturally and linguistically diverse students in secondary classrooms, disciplinary literacy, teacher beliefs and professional learning, and the experiences of women of color in the academy.
Dobbs has published in journals including Journal of Adolescent and Adult Literacy, TESOL Journal, Reading and Writing, English Journal, Bilingual Research Journal, Reading Research Quarterly, Professional Development in Education, and Journal of School Leadership. Her books include Investigating Disciplinary Literacy, Disciplinary Literacy Inquiry & Instruction (2nd ed.), Critical Disciplinary Literacy, and, as an editor, The Impacts of Censorship, Vol. 1: Research on the Intersection of Censorship and Teaching English.
